As a small business owner, managing your finances effectively is crucial for the success and growth of your business. By following these tips on how to successfully manage your small business finances, you can ensure that your business remains financially healthy and sustainable.

Assess Your Current Financial Situation

Before you can create a successful financial plan for your small business, it is important to assess your current financial situation. Gather all relevant financial documents and data to get a clear picture of where your business stands financially. Calculate your current cash flow and analyze your profit margins to understand how money is flowing in and out of your business. Identify any outstanding debts or expenses that may be impacting your financial health.

Create a Financial Plan

Once you have a clear understanding of your current financial situation, it is time to create a financial plan for your small business. Set specific financial goals that align with the overall goals of your business. Develop a budget that outlines how you will allocate your resources to achieve those goals. Determine key performance indicators that will allow you to track your financial progress and make adjustments as needed.

Implement Financial Controls

Establishing financial controls is essential for managing your small business finances effectively. Create a system for tracking income and expenses that is easy to use and understand. Set up regular financial reviews and audits to ensure that your finances are in order. Develop protocols for managing payroll, invoicing, and billing to avoid any financial discrepancies.

Monitor and Adjust Your Financial Strategy

Monitoring your financial strategy is key to ensuring the long-term success of your small business. Regularly review financial reports and compare them against your established goals. Make adjustments to your budget and financial plan as needed to stay on track. Seek professional advice or guidance from a financial advisor or accountant to help you make informed decisions about your finances.

Ensure Compliance with Financial Regulations

Staying compliant with financial regulations is essential for protecting your small business and avoiding any legal issues. Stay up-to-date on tax laws and regulations that may impact your business. Maintain organized and accurate financial records to ensure that you are prepared for any audits or inspections. Consult with a financial advisor or accountant to ensure that your business is in compliance with all relevant financial laws and regulations.

By following these tips on how to successfully manage your small business finances, you can set your business up for long-term financial success. Remember to assess your current financial situation, create a financial plan, implement financial controls, monitor and adjust your financial strategy, and ensure compliance with financial regulations. With careful planning and attention to detail, you can ensure that your small business remains financially healthy and sustainable.
